====================================================================== From the HSLDA E-lert Service... ====================================================================== March 2, 2004 Iowa--Calls Needed-Parent Directed Driver Ed Heads For Crucial Vote Dear HSLDA members and friends: A bill that would allow homeschool parents to teach driver's education to their own children, (HF 2394), was approved by the House Education Committee last week and now heads for a vote on the House floor. Parent taught driver's education saves lives. Although driver education is theoretically available through school districts, many homeschool students are turned away because the classes are full, and even if they are admitted, the cost can be prohibitively expensive. Homeschooling for driver education works. We need your help now to get this message to the House of Representatives. According to a study by the University of Colorado-Colorado Springs, teenage injuries and deaths were dramatically lower for teens who learned to drive using a homeschool driver education program. The total number of accidents and tickets was also dramatically lower. 2. Homeschooled students are frequently turned away from public school driver education classes because the classes are full. 3. Public school driver education courses are expensive, and getting more expensive. 4. No professional driver teacher cares as much about your child as you do. Parent taught driver education is highly successful for the same reason that parent taught academics are highly successful: highly individualized attention, flexible scheduling, parent child interaction, and greater opportunity for accountability.
